Dr. Steve Hoffman developed Mastering Chiropractic with Certainty (MC2) as a technic in the 1990's. Among the major technic influencers behind MC2 were HIO from B.J. Palmer, Dr. Hubert Hitchcock and Life Upper Cervical Technic, Dr. Michael Kale (Kale Specific), Dr. Joe Lipari (BioToning), Dr. Tim Tarry, Dr. Bob Kribs (Grostic), Dr. Joe Stuckey (Integrated Methods), Dr. Joe Flesia, Dr. Pat Gentempo, and Dr. Jay Holder (TRT).
Subluxation correction always involves the skeletal, nervous and muscle systems. They can be differentiated from one another based on the system that is the primary focus and, hence, the method of analysis.
Segmental approaches focus first on structure and adjust vertebrae that are not in their optimum position back to a more normal position and, in so doing, affect the nervous system first and then the muscle system next.
Postural techniques seek to affect the muscle system first, which then affects the skeletal system and then, finally, the nervous system. Tonal chiropractic puts its focus on the nervous system and is physiology based. Here, the nervous system is addressed first which then affects the muscle system which, in turn, affects the skeletal system. Why tonal? Your nerve system is your interface with the world. Bones cannot move into abnormal positions by themselves so a muscle imbalance must occur first. Muscles do not act on their own so a muscle imbalance must result from an unbalanced nerve supply to the muscles. The bone can only move if a muscle moves it and a muscle will only move when the nervous system tells it to. It just makes more sense to us to address the nervous system first so all else can follow.
